Jonathan Majors’ attorneys have denied any wrongdoing, stating that the arrest was made due to NYPD procedure.

“Unfortunately, this incident came about because this woman was having an emotional crisis, for which she was taken to a hospital yesterday,” attorney Priya Chaudhry told Variety. “The NYPD is required to make an arrest in these situations, and this is the only reason Mr. Majors was arrested. We expect these charges to be dropped soon.”

His attorney’s statements certainly shine a new light for Majors, whose rising status in the industry could be thrown into limbo by the allegations. Majors, who scored his breakout role with 2019’s “The Last Black Man in San Francisco,” appeared in films like “Da 5 Bloods” and “The Harder They Fall” before scoring some big roles in 2023, including appearances in “Ant-Man and the Wasp: Quantumania” and “Creed III.”

Majors also has several other upcoming movies planned for the near future that could be affected by the allegations against him. This not only includes Spike Lee’s “Da Understudy,” Phil Lord and Chris Miller’s “48 Hours in Las Vegas,” and the Walter Mosley novel adaptation of “The Man in my Basement,” but also the Avengers films, “Avengers: The Kang Dynasty” and “Avengers: Secret Wars,” which will see him be the heroes’ next major adversary.
